Scrum of scrums/2020-01-22
Appearance
2020-01-22
[edit]Callouts
[edit]- No SoS next week because of Wikimedia Foundation All Hands
- Release Engineering
- January 27-31 - No deploys at all (including train), All-Hands
- The weekly MediaWiki branch cut is moving to full automation soon. If the timing of the branch cut affects you, please join the discussion at phab:T242446
- Quality and Test Engineering
- Blocked by Core Platform? - Login to at least en.wikipedia.beta.wmflabs.org and commons.wikimedia.beta.wmflabs.org sometimes fails with `There seems to be a problem with your login session` phab:T243123
SoS Meeting Bookkeeping
[edit]- Updates:
- No SoS next week because of Wikimedia Foundation All Hands
Product
[edit]Editing
[edit]- Updates:
- Preparing to release v1.0 of replying workflow for DiscussionTools (phab:T235592)
Growth
[edit]- Updates:
- Topic matching for suggested edits is now live on our target wikis!
- Working on ORES drafttopic model use for topics for suggested edits, and adding guidance features to the suggested edits module
iOS native app
[edit]- Updates:
- Working on 6.6 release (mobile-html integration) phab:project/view/4273
- Investigating bug where donations continue to come through iOS phab:T242347
Android native app
[edit]- Updates:
- Completed prototype of image tagging for Commons (based on suggested tags from Machine Vision api)
- Finishing up mobile-html integration.
Web
[edit]- Updates:
- Summary: continuing desktop improvements (DIP).
- Desktop Improvements Project (Vector / DIP):
- Mobile website (MinervaNeue / MobileFrontend):
- Advanced mode:
- Miscellaneous:
- Regression: issues with MobileDiff
- [EPIC] Re-define the contract for displaying drawers and overlays in MobileFrontend
- The `site` and `site.styles` module should be explicitly disabled on mobile rather than abuse the targets system
- The LoadingOverlay and src/mobile.startup/rlModuleLoader.js pattern should be removed - it results in overlay flashes during switches
- [EPIC] Minerva works independently of MobileFrontend
- Transition MobileFrontend Gruntfile.js tasks to NPM scripts
- Respect $wgAllowSiteCSSOnRestrictedPages
- QuickSurveys
Structured Data
[edit]- Blocking:
- Search Platform: Data dumps for SDC: phab:T221917
- I don't think we're really blocking this - afaik nobody's waiting for anything from us, and Ariel is testing dumps
- Updates:
- working on new input types
- also prototyping media search
Inuka
[edit]- Updates:
- KaiOS app: Article footer phab:T236301
- KaiOS app: Empty state on various screens phab:T242350
- KaiOS app: Change text size phab:T234622
Technology
[edit]Fundraising Tech
[edit]- Updates:
- payments-wiki: more work to support recurring donation via our backup card provider:
- CentralNotice
- deploying a fix for campaign fallback: phab:T240802
- more work on region-level geotargeting:
- starting to set up our Cloud VPS project for testing unmerged changes: phab:T241070 (thanks, Tech engagment team!)
- CiviCRM
- Trying to upstream some of our last local performance hacks:
- More improvements to contact de-duplication: phab:T242159
- Making our multilanguage Thank You emails sendable from the UI: phab:T227903
- Fully squashing a recurring donation schedule bug we thought we fixed in December: phab:T243356
- Upgrading our production instance to latest Civi core: phab:T242056
Core Platform
[edit]- Blocking:
- Search Platform: MW Job consumers sometimes pause for several minutes phab:T224425
- WMDE: Waiting for feedback form core platform team regarding phab:T233520
- QTE: (Maybe) - Login to at least en.wikipedia.beta.wmflabs.org and commons.wikimedia.beta.wmflabs.org sometimes fails with `There seems to be a problem with your login session` phab:T243123
- Updates:
- Echo notification storage rolled out
- OAuth 2.0 rolled out
- Session storage rolling out this week
Engineering Productivity
[edit]Quality and Test Engineering
[edit]- Blocked by:
- Core Platform? - Login to at least en.wikipedia.beta.wmflabs.org and commons.wikimedia.beta.wmflabs.org sometimes fails with `There seems to be a problem with your login session` phab:T243123
Release Engineering
[edit]- Updates:
- The weekly MediaWiki branch cut is moving to full automation soon. If the timing of the branch cut affects you, please join the discussion at phab:T242446
- Train Health
- This week: 1.35.0-wmf.16 - phab:T233864
- Next week: No deploys at all (including train), Wikimedia Foundation All Hands - phab:T233865
Scoring Platform
[edit]- Updates:
- Major improvements in topic modeling fitness for enwiki (Pending deployment) phab:T243107
- Expanding native topic models to ar, cs, ko, and viwiki. phab:T243108
- Brought experimental cluster back online after service interruption phab:T242819
- Still exploring an OOM issue in prod that had a very minor effect on the service phab:T242705
Search Platform
[edit]- Blocked by:
- Structured Data: Data dumps for SDC: phab:T221917
- Core: MW Job consumers sometimes pause for several minutes phab:T224425
- Updates:
- Implement sonarcloud integration for Java projects phab:T238004
Security
[edit]- Updates:
- kaiOS in progress: phab:T240869
- Inuka in progress: phab:T240010
- closed: phab:T239063
- new Security SOP: Security/SOP/Requests_For_Service
Wikimedia DE
[edit]Wikidata
[edit]- Blocked by:
- Waiting for feedback form core platform team regarding phab:T233520